Intel Extends Embedded Offerings With Intel Core 2 Duo Processors |

Intel Corporation has expanded the life cycle support for the Intel Core 2 Duo E6400 and T7400 processors for embedded applications, ranging from bank ATMs to Point-Of-Sale (POS) cash registers.
Based on the Intel Core micro architecture, these two Intel dual-core processors aim to expand the portfolio of high-performance solutions with life cycle support for five to seven years for its embedded customers.
System-enhancing hardware innovations such as Intel Virtualisation Technology (Intel VT) are also supported in the E6400 and T7400 processors. With Intel VT, embedded applications running on separate platforms can be consolidated onto a single platform, helping to fuel cost savings and improve reliability and manageability.
Intel is also announcing extended lifecycle support for the latest chipset to pair with the Core 2 Duo E6400, the Intel Q965 Express chipset. This innovative chipset provides Intel Active Management Technology (Intel AMT) capabilities, which allows for remote management and minimises productivity loss due to system downtime. The Intel Core 2 Duo T7400 processor has been validated with the Intel 945GM Express chipset, an extended lifecycle chipset announced earlier this year.
The Intel Core 2 Duo E6400 and T7400 processors are currently available and priced at USD 224 and USD 423 respectively, in 1,000-unit quantities.
